Apple and Google Face Backlash Over ‘Nudification’ Apps
The tech giants, Apple and Google, have been issued cease-and-desist letters by authorities demanding that they remove apps that can manipulate or alter images of people, making them appear naked or semi-naked. These apps, which use art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) algorithms, have been causing concern among lawmakers and advocacy groups due to their potential to spread harm and promote the exploitation of individuals.
Background and Context
The issue of ‘nudification’ apps has been gaining attention in recent years, particularly among teenagers and young adults. These apps, often marketed as ‘meme generators’ or ‘image editors,’ allow users to manipulate images of people, making them appear in various states of undress. While some may view these apps as harmless or even entertaining, others see them as a threat to individuals’ dignity, consent, and safety.
The cease-and-desist letters, issued by regulatory bodies in several countries, accuse Apple and Google of profiting from the sale of these apps. The letters argue that by hosting and promoting these apps, the tech giants are enabling the spread of harmful content and contributing to the exploitation of vulnerable individuals.
Reasons Behind the Backlash
- The rise of social media has created a culture where individuals feel pressure to present a curated online persona, often blurring the lines between reality and fantasy.
- The ease of access to ‘nudification’ apps has made it simple for users to manipulate and share manipulated images, often with devastating consequences for the subjects of these images.
- The tech giants’ failure to regulate these apps has been criticized, with many arguing that they have a responsibility to protect their users from harm.
Lawmakers and advocacy groups have been pushing for stricter regulations on ‘nudification’ apps, arguing that they promote a culture of objectification and exploitation. The issue has also sparked debates about free speech, censorship, and the role of technology in society.
